
python如何采集数据库数据库
用户关注问题
如何使用Python连接和采集数据库中的数据?
我想用Python从数据库中获取数据,应该使用哪些库和基本流程是什么?
Python数据库连接和数据采集方法
可以使用Python的数据库接口库如sqlite3、PyMySQL、psycopg2等,根据所用数据库类型选择对应驱动。连接数据库主要步骤包括安装驱动,建立连接,创建游标,执行SQL查询,获取结果和关闭连接。
采集数据库数据时如何保证数据的安全和完整性?
在用Python采集数据库时,如何防止数据泄露和确保数据正确完整?
采集数据库数据时的数据安全措施
应避免将数据库账号密码硬编码在代码中,可使用配置文件或环境变量存储敏感信息。执行SQL语句时,使用参数化查询以防止SQL注入。采集完数据后,务必关闭游标和连接以释放资源,保证数据传输和存储的安全和完整。
Python采集大型数据库数据时如何提高效率?
面对大数据量的数据库,用Python采集时有哪些优化技巧?
提升Python采集大型数据库数据效率的策略
可以通过分页查询(LIMIT/OFFSET)、批量获取数据、使用数据库索引优化查询、采用异步库如asyncpg,或者利用多线程、多进程编程来并行采集数据,从而提高采集效率。